Scott McTominay back in training after missing last two games with injury

Scott McTominay is back in first-team training after missing the last couple of games with an injury issue.

Suddenly, Manchester United’s squad is looking rather healthy again. Alex Telles is over his bout of coronavirus, Luke Shaw is working towards full fitness while Paul Pogba is also back out on the grass.

Another player who has been sidelined recently is Scot McTominay. The midfielder has actually missed the last couple of games with an injury issue. However, he’s given United a boost ahead of the PSG home game by making his return to first-team training.

In McTominay’s absence, it’s Nemanja Matic who is often tasked with playing in that defensive midfield role. Against Southampton at the weekend, the Serb offered up a real mixed bag. After a poor first 45, Matic would bounce back in the second and play an absolute blinder.

One thing Matic doesn’t have is much mobility and energy. Against PSG, that’s exactly what you’re going to need, particularly in midfield. McTominay offers that in abundance and his return to the grass couldn’t have been any more timely.

I guess it’s now a case of whether McTominay is fit enough to go 90 minutes in what’s going to be a high-intensity game. You know the Scotland international will give it his absolute all if called upon, it’s just a question of whether his body will allow it.

Personally, I’d give him the start and re-assess the situation at half-time. McTominay with Bruno Fernandes and Donny van de Beek sitting in front of him feels like the best midfield trio we have at the moment.

That said, I wouldn’t be surprised to see Fred given the nod ahead of Van de Beek here, as Ole Gunnar Solskjaer will be desperate for a result. And you could hardly blame him for sticking with what he knows…
